Abstract: A polyurethane acrylate (A), comprises, as synthesis components, (a) at least one polyisocyanate which comprises isocyanurate groups, based on 1-isocyanato-3,3,5-trimethyl-5-(isocyanatomethyl)cyclohexane, (b) at least one polyisocyanate which comprises isocyanurate groups, based on hexamethylene diisocyanate, (c) at least one aliphatic and/or cycloaliphatic diisocyanate, (d1) at least one polyetherdiol or polyesterdiol having a molecular weight ranging from 500 to 2000, (d2) optionally, at least one diol having a molecular weight of less than 220 g/mol, (e) at least one compound having at least one group reactive toward isocyanate and at least one unsaturated group capable of free radical polymerization, and (f) optionally, at least one compound having exactly one group reactive toward isocyanate.

Abstract: The invention relates to compositions, comprising. a)1.00 to 65.00% by weight of at least one compound of formula (I), wherein R1, R2, R3, R4 are each independently H, C1-C6-alkyl, C1-C6-alkoxy, or C1-C6-alkoxy-C1-C6-alkyl; R is H or C1-C6-alkyl; X is CR6R7, O, or NR8; R6R7 are each independently H, C1-C6-alkyl, C1-C6-alkoxy, or C1-C6-alkoxy-C1-C6-alkyl; R8 is H, C1-C6-alkyl, or C1-C6-alkoxy-C1-C6-alkyl; k is 1, 2, 3, 4 or 5, as component A; b) 1.00 to 60.00% by weight of at least one monomer having two (meth)acrylate groups and having a molecular weight of no more than 500 Dalton, as component B; c) 0 to 25% by weight of at least one monomer having at least three (meth)acrylate groups and having a molecular weight of no more than 600 Dalton, as component C; and d) 1.00 to 30.00% by weight of at least one polymer having at least two (meth)acrylate groups and having a molecular weight of at least 700 Dalton, as component D; with the proviso that the amount of components A + B is at least 50% by weight, as well as the use of these compositions as printing inks, in particular inkjet printing inks.

Abstract: Described are electrochromic devices and compositions as well as manufacturing methods for making such electrochromic devices by printing or wet processing of the compositions. The compositions are in the form of a suspension and comprise two or more monomers, nanoparticles of an electrochromic metal oxide, one or more metal salts of the form (M)z(R)y, where M is a metal cation and R is the corresponding salt anion, a carrier liquid and a solvent. The compositions are polymerised to form a composite layer comprising a polymer matrix that hosts the electrochromic nanoparticles and the electrolyte. At least a part of the metal salts (e.g. zinc acetate) is physically adsorbed onto the surface of the nanoparticles and acts as a dispersant.
